Points & Rewards
Encourage customer loyalty. Let shoppers earn points they can redeem for discounts on future purchases.
Points & Rewards Module Overview
The Points & Rewards module enables you to reward your returning customers by giving them discounts based on points earned from their past purchases. This motivates repeat buying behaviour and helps build a stronger long-term relationship with your clients. Shoppers can collect points and redeem them for discounts on future orders, turning everyday shopping into a rewarding and engaging experience.
- Automatically reward customers for every purchase
- Drive repeat business with redeemable loyalty points
- Support long-term retention of your customers
- Simple yet effective loyalty programme integration


Earn Points from Each Product Purchase
After the module is enabled, every item in your shop becomes an opportunity to earn reward points. Shoppers automatically collect points based on the price of the product—for example, a product priced at R290 would give 290 points when bought. This encourages customers to spend more, come back often, and use their points, creating a cycle of stronger engagement and improved satisfaction.
- Points allocated based on item’s selling price
- Encourages larger baskets and repeat purchases
- Runs automatically once module is enabled
- Adjust how many points each product awards
Reward Points After Order Completion
Reward points are automatically added to a customer’s balance as soon as the order status moves to “Completed”. Clients can then use their collected points for discounts during checkout on their next purchases. This automated flow ensures the process is easy and reliable for both customers and the shop administrator, with no extra admin work required.
- Assign reward points when order is completed
- Encourage repeat shopping with future discounts
- Automatic backend tracking of reward balances
- Reduce admin workload through smart triggers


Customer Reward Points Management
Within the customer account section, shoppers can view their current reward point balance and monitor how many points they have earned over time. From the admin side, you have complete control to add or remove points from a client’s profile, allowing you to reward loyalty, resolve issues, or run special promotions. This makes for transparent, efficient, and trustworthy points management across the whole shop.
- Shoppers can track points from their account
- Admins may add or deduct points manually
- Support customer service and loyalty drives
- Provide flexible and transparent points control
Optional Extension for eCommerce
The Points & Rewards module is an optional add-on for your eCommerce shop, designed to make online shopping more engaging and customer-centred. Through the settings, you can define exactly how much each point is worth—for example, 100 points could equal a R10 discount. You maintain full control of the conversion rate, redemption limits, and expiry rules so that the loyalty system fits neatly with your overall business strategy.
- Set your own point-to-currency values
- Manage redemption rules and expiry periods
- Align reward logic with business objectives
- Quick setup through a simple admin panel

You may also be interested
Discover more premium modules from HitMe